Jarrell Plantation is a mid-nineteenth-century cotton plantation owned by only one loved ones for nearly a century as well as a half. Its importance lies while in the complicated’s preservation of vernacular household types, which document constructional procedures and supplies use while in the mid-nineteenth- to early-twentieth-century outbuildings that are extant below.

Down a sleepy roadway off I-seventy five, past a former movie set, and tucked in the Piedmont Nationwide Forest is Jarrell Plantation State Historic Site. The Jarrell family lived and worked in this article for over a hundred twenty five several years, from 1847 in to the sixties. It’s not the Hollywood Model of a plantation, it’s the true deal, as well as 20 original constructions clearly show everyday living pre-Civil War, along with the many adjustments that occurred afterward.

Federal troops less than William T. Sherman handed by means of Jarrell Plantation in 1864, thieving livestock and meals, and burning the plantation’s to start with gin home. It was replaced by John, but by the point of his Dying in 1884, the diminished estate, operate by seven farmhands, was truly worth only about $2,743. By the top of century, lots of the farmhands experienced abandoned the plantation and the sooner slave residences deteriorated and disappeared; just the spoil of one is preserved now.
